Calico cat is not a breed it's the colouration in them which gives them a name. Generally Calicos cats are females, as it is because of the presence of orange or black colour which express X chromosomes.
Female Calico cats carry two X chromosomes out of which one is from mother which represents orange colour and the other X chromosomes is from the father which represents black colour. And the white colour is caused because of the other genes.
Male calico cats are generally sterile and rare. The colour pattern present in the calico cat is due to sex-linked genetics and epigenetic. The inactivated X chromosome causes the colour pattern.
Genetically two x chromosomes are needed to produce a calico cat. If the colours are black orange upon the coat of a cat then that is said to be a calico cat and if the colours are blue creams instead of black orange then it is said to be a muted calicos .
Calico cats has tri colour on their coat. The colours present in calico cat can be red or cream, white, black, blue, brown, blue. The variations in colours are caused by the genes which dilutes and lighten up the basic colour and thus muted calico cats are produced. Muted calico cat have white cream and blue colour in them.
